I recently bought an HP Victus 15-fb2000nr. I am wondering if it's possible to limit the battery charge to 80% since I will use it mostly for gaming while plugged it. I don't want to wear down my battery.

The "Adaptive Battery Optimizer" in BIOS is enabled but it still charged to 100%. Any solution?

Unfortunately, that is not possible for your notebook.

 

Only some HP business class notebooks have that feature.

 

See the link below for how to get the most life out of your notebook's battery:

 

HP Notebook PCs and Chromebooks - Improving battery performance | HP® Support

 

My only suggestion is to not leave the notebook plugged into A/C power 24/7/365 with the battery in a constant 100% charge state.

 

Run the notebook off the battery once in a while.
